Apollo.io

QA 工程师

at Apollo.io
技术与编程 全职 India
536天前

详细信息

工作摘要:

作为QA工程师,您将参与我们的整个工程组织的质量工程计划。您将与具有不同背景的产品开发工程师和SRE紧密合作,共同构建自动化测试工具和最佳实践。Apollo Engineering坚信允许团队成员拥有他们所做的事情的所有权,我们解决问题的方法在很大程度上依赖于创造力、沟通和协作。

工作职责:

作为QA工程师,您将负责:

  • 自动化测试

    • 遵守QE流程和方法论的所有方面,并确保其有效性并符合行业最佳实践

    • 为自动化框架如Cypress设计和开发QE工件

    • 根据质量标准实现QE目标和向客户交付成果

    • 准备、审查和维护测试文档(测试计划、测试案例、测试报告),以确保完整的测试覆盖率

    • 根据产品需求自动化测试案例

  • 项目任务

    • 执行所需的QE测试活动(测试案例准备、测试执行、环境设置、安装等)

    • 使用现代项目管理软件如JIRA组织史诗、故事和票据并跟踪进度

    • 为项目收集需求

    • 必要时管理或准备客户演示项目交付成果

    • 提供所需的功能开发估算和计划

    • 将更大的任务拆分为较小的任务,并确定它们应完成的顺序

    • 使用敏捷项目管理技术,如站立会议和每周冲刺计划

  • 跨职能协作

    • 以书面和口头形式向软件开发人员传达技术思想

    • 为项目提供战略性测试计划,以引入高效技术和测试生产力改进

    • 必要时与公司不同办公室的其他团队合作,以实现组织目标

    • 管理风险和交付成果,确保测试活动保持在约定的范围、时间表、预算和质量标准内

工作技能和经验:

  • 3年以上作为软件QA工程师的经验

  • 计算机科学、工程或相关资格的学位

  • 开发、维护并执行冒烟、回归、功能、性能和其他测试案例

  • 熟练掌握任何编程语言/编码,包括Python、Ruby和JavaScript

  • 有UI自动化测试和框架如Cypress、Selenium以及javascript/typescript/ruby的经验和良好理解

  • 在软件测试、质量改进、质量流程、质量保证方法论和最佳实践方面的经验

  • API测试(手动和自动化适用)

  • 具有SQL经验

  • 熟悉敏捷测试方法论和最佳实践

  • 现代持续集成和持续部署技术及技术。熟悉git/bitbucket/gitlab等工具

  • 在快节奏环境中独立和高效地工作的能力

  • 熟悉迁移测试

  • 熟悉AWS/GCP云工具/技术

  • 熟悉非功能测试 - 跨浏览器测试、性能和负载测试

  • 熟悉rails控制台(Ruby on rails应用程序)

  • 熟悉Linux容器和虚拟化(Docker)

  • 熟悉Kubernetes,Docker Compose

首选技能:

  • 强大的解决问题能力和技术推理能力

  • 跨职能与其他工程团队合作的能力

  • 对学习新技术有强烈兴趣


免责声明

该远程工作信息来源于站外平台,本站仅提供部分信息展示与订阅服务,更多请查看免责声明

关注公众号,不定期副业成功案例分享
关注公众号

不定期副业成功案例分享

领先一步获取最新的外包任务吗?

立即订阅